By replacing batteries with Nuvera's PowerEdge fuel cell system in electric forklift trucks, customers have shown a greater than 10% increase in productivity and cut truck maintenance costs in half.

Nuvera's cutting-edge hydrogen generation and refueling station, called PowerTap, produces hydrogen from natural gas for a cost-competitive, convenient, and safe solution at your facility. PowerTap can offer significant cost savings compared with liquid and tube trailer hydrogen - and according to a National Lab study, PowerTap affords a 33% reduction in carbon emissions compared with batteries charged from the grid.
